技术领域 technical field
本发明涉及农机领域,具体为一种小型玉米秸秆切割机。 The invention relates to the field of agricultural machinery, in particular to a small corn stalk cutting machine.
背景技术 Background technique
玉米是我国北方地区的一种重要的粮食作物,但由于其植株、生长状况等原因,难以做到如小麦的大型机械化收割,使得大部分玉米的收获及秸秆的处理都必须依靠人工,这已经成为玉米收获时节最为繁重的劳动,占整个玉米生产劳动总量的60%以上。近年来,随着越来越多的农村青壮年劳动力转向城镇,许多地方季节性劳动力短缺的问题变得日益严重,农村生活条件的改善和经济收入的提高,农民迫切需要机械化手段来提高玉米收获的生产效率,降低其劳动力度。 Corn is an important food crop in northern my country, but due to its plant, growth conditions and other reasons, it is difficult to achieve large-scale mechanized harvesting such as wheat, so most of the harvesting of corn and the treatment of straw must rely on manual labor. It becomes the heaviest labor in the corn harvest season, accounting for more than 60% of the total labor in corn production. In recent years, as more and more young and middle-aged laborers in rural areas turn to cities, the problem of seasonal labor shortage in many places has become increasingly serious. With the improvement of rural living conditions and economic income, farmers urgently need mechanized means to increase corn harvest The production efficiency, reduce its labor intensity.
随着农民对玉米收获机械的需求越来越大,一些企业的研发部门也明确了方向,同时,政府部门在农业机械购置的补贴政策已经向玉米收割机械方向倾斜,一些省市地区设置了地方购机补贴专项资金,这些都大大推动了玉米收割机械化的快速发展。另外,政府的有关部门也采取了一些强有力的措施建立了多元化的资金投入机制,给玉米生产机械化的发展营造了较好的资金投入机制,为玉米收获机械的发展营造出良好的背景条件。 As farmers' demand for corn harvesting machinery is increasing, the research and development departments of some enterprises have also clarified their direction. Special funds for machine purchase subsidies have greatly promoted the rapid development of corn harvesting mechanization. In addition, relevant government departments have also taken some strong measures to establish a diversified capital investment mechanism, which has created a better capital investment mechanism for the development of corn production mechanization and created a good background for the development of corn harvesting machinery. .
发明内容 Contents of the invention
本发明的目的在于提供一种小型玉米秸秆切割机,以解决上述问题。 The object of the present invention is to provide a small corn stalk cutter to solve the above problems.
为实现上述目的,本发明提出的技术方案为: To achieve the above object, the technical solution proposed by the present invention is:
小型玉米秸秆切割机,包括动力部分、收割部分和车身部分,所述动力部分设置在车身部分内,收割部分设置在车身部分前方,包括支撑台,在支撑台有垂直向的主动轴和从动轴通过转动连接设置,所述主动轴与从动轴的上端通过皮带与带轮连接,所述皮带的外侧均匀设置有若干抛爪,抛爪为长条状硬质结构,垂直固定在皮带的外侧;所述主动轴和从动轴的下端安装有割刀,割刀为边缘均匀设置有若干圆弧状刀片的法兰盘结构。 A small corn stalk cutting machine includes a power part, a harvesting part and a body part. The power part is arranged in the body part, and the harvesting part is arranged in front of the body part. The shaft is connected by rotation, and the upper end of the driving shaft and the driven shaft are connected to the pulley through a belt. There are a number of throwing claws evenly arranged on the outside of the belt. The throwing claws are elongated hard structures and are vertically fixed on the Outer side; the lower ends of the driving shaft and the driven shaft are equipped with a cutting knife, and the cutting knife is a flange structure with a number of arc-shaped blades evenly arranged on the edge.
在本发明中,在所述支撑台设置主动轴的一侧,设置有拨禾轮,拨禾轮为带有长齿的轮状结构,通过支架固定在支撑台侧面,通过皮带由主动轴带动转动。 In the present invention, a reel is provided on the side where the drive shaft is set on the support platform, and the reel is a wheel-shaped structure with long teeth, fixed on the side of the support platform through a bracket, and driven by the drive shaft through a belt turn.
进一步的,所述拨禾轮、割刀、抛爪、主动轴和从动轴的转动方向一致。 Further, the rotation directions of the reel, cutter, throwing claw, driving shaft and driven shaft are consistent.
在本发明中,所述主动轴与从动轴通过轴承安装在支撑台上。 In the present invention, the driving shaft and the driven shaft are installed on the supporting platform through bearings.
在本发明中,所述车身部分包括车体、前轮、后轮和设置在车体后方的扶柄,所述车身部分为后轮驱动,后轮及其连接后轮的后轮轴由动力部分带动。 In the present invention, the vehicle body part includes a vehicle body, a front wheel, a rear wheel and a handle arranged at the rear of the vehicle body, the vehicle body part is driven by the rear wheel, and the rear wheel and the rear wheel shaft connected to the rear wheel are driven by the power part drive.
在本发明中,所述动力部分包括发动机和减速器,分别通过传动带带动收割部分的主动轴旋转和行车部分的后轮轴转动。 In the present invention, the power part includes an engine and a speed reducer, which respectively drive the driving shaft of the harvesting part to rotate and the rear wheel shaft of the driving part to rotate through the transmission belt.
进一步的,所述车体内设置有转向装置,使发动机和减速器分别带动后轮轴和主动轴,在本发明中,所述转向装置包括圆锥齿轮。 Further, a steering device is provided in the vehicle body, so that the engine and the speed reducer respectively drive the rear wheel shaft and the driving shaft. In the present invention, the steering device includes a bevel gear.
在本发明中,所述后轮轴上还设置有离合器。 In the present invention, a clutch is also arranged on the rear axle.
在本发明中,所述收割部分可直接与手扶拖拉机匹配安装。 In the present invention, the harvesting part can be directly matched and installed with the walking tractor.
与现有技术相比,本发明的优点在于: Compared with the prior art, the present invention has the advantages of:
(1)结构新颖,抛爪的结构能够夹持玉米秸秆移动到从动轴的位置,搬运效果很好; (1) The structure is novel, the structure of the throwing claw can hold the corn stalk and move it to the position of the driven shaft, and the handling effect is very good;
(2)法兰盘割刀的设置,结构简单,拆装方便,刀片可以替换,节约成本,工作效率高; (2) The setting of the flange cutter has a simple structure, easy disassembly and assembly, and the blade can be replaced, saving cost and high work efficiency;
(3)动力部分采用传动带和圆锥齿轮,能够有效的防止机械过载时,零件会被破坏,传动带能够有效的起到缓冲作用,圆锥齿轮还能起到减速和改变转矩的传递作用,从而将动力分别传递给车身行走和收割部分工作; (3) The power part adopts transmission belt and bevel gear, which can effectively prevent the parts from being damaged when the machine is overloaded. The power is transmitted to the body walking and harvesting parts respectively;
(4)收割部分可单独拆下来安装在手扶拖拉机上,适应性好,方便了人们的动力选择,提高了设备的实用性。 (4) The harvesting part can be disassembled and installed on the walking tractor separately, which has good adaptability, facilitates people's power selection, and improves the practicability of the equipment.

具体实施方式 Detailed ways
以下结合说明书附图和具体优选的实施例对本发明作进一步描述,但并不因此而限制本发明的保护范围。 The present invention will be further described below in conjunction with the accompanying drawings and specific preferred embodiments, but the protection scope of the present invention is not limited thereby.
参见图1~4所示的小型玉米秸秆切割机,包括动力部分、收割部分和车身部分,所述动力部分设置在车身部分内,收割部分设置在车身部分前方,包括支撑台9,在支撑台9有垂直向的主动轴7和从动轴8通过轴承4安装设置,所述主动轴7与从动轴8的上端通过皮带与带轮2连接,所述皮带的外侧均匀设置有若干抛爪3,抛爪3为长条状硬质结构,垂直固定在皮带的外侧;所述主动轴7和从动轴8的下端安装有割刀10,割刀10为边缘均匀设置有若干圆弧状刀片的法兰盘结构;在所述支撑台9设置主动轴7的一侧,还设置有拨禾轮5,拨禾轮5为带有长齿的轮状结构,通过支架6固定在支撑台9上,通过皮带由主动轴7带动转动。所述拨禾轮5、割刀10、抛爪3、主动轴7和从动轴8的转动方向一致。 Referring to the small-sized corn stalk cutting machine shown in Figures 1 to 4, it includes a power part, a harvesting part and a body part. 9 The vertical driving shaft 7 and driven shaft 8 are installed through the bearing 4, the upper ends of the driving shaft 7 and the driven shaft 8 are connected to the pulley 2 through a belt, and a number of throwing claws are uniformly arranged on the outside of the belt 3. The throwing claw 3 is a long strip hard structure, which is vertically fixed on the outside of the belt; the lower ends of the driving shaft 7 and the driven shaft 8 are equipped with cutting knives 10, and the cutting knives 10 are uniformly arranged with a number of arc-shaped The flange structure of the blade; on the side where the driving shaft 7 is set on the support platform 9, a reel 5 is also provided, and the reel 5 is a wheel-shaped structure with long teeth, which is fixed on the support platform by a bracket 6 9, driven by the drive shaft 7 to rotate by the belt. The rotation directions of the reel 5, the cutting knife 10, the throwing claw 3, the driving shaft 7 and the driven shaft 8 are consistent.
在本发明中,所述车身部分包括车体1、前轮11、后轮12和设置在车体1后方的扶柄13,所述车身部分为后轮12驱动,后轮12及其连接后轮12的后轮轴14由动力部分带动,所述动力部分包括发动机19和减速器18,分别通过传动带16和圆锥齿轮17结构带动收割部分的主动轴7旋转和行车部分的后轮轴14转动。所述后轮轴14上还设置有离合器15。 In the present invention, the body part includes a car body 1, a front wheel 11, a rear wheel 12 and a handle 13 arranged at the rear of the car body 1. The car body part is driven by the rear wheel 12, and the rear wheel 12 and its connected The rear wheel shaft 14 of wheel 12 is driven by power part, and described power part comprises engine 19 and speed reducer 18, drives the drive shaft 7 rotation of harvesting part and the rear wheel shaft 14 rotation of driving part by drive belt 16 and conical gear 17 structure respectively. A clutch 15 is also arranged on the rear wheel shaft 14 .
本发明所述的小型玉米秸秆切割机应用于田间玉米秸秆切割时,发动机19带动后轮12和主动轴7的转动,整个设备在田间移动,位于设备前方靠右的秸秆先由拨禾轮5拨向主动轴7的割刀10,秸秆被割刀10切断后,拨禾轮5将秸秆拨进抛爪3,随后抛爪3带动秸秆移动,夹持至左方后抛下,位于设备前方靠左的秸秆直接由从动轴8的割刀10切断,并直接抛掷到左方。收割部分再发动机19的带动下连续工作,车身部分也带动着整台设备不断向前行走。 When the small-sized corn stalk cutting machine of the present invention is applied to cutting corn stalks in the field, the engine 19 drives the rotation of the rear wheel 12 and the driving shaft 7, and the whole equipment moves in the field, and the straw located on the right in front of the equipment is first moved by the reel 5 Turn to the cutter 10 of the driving shaft 7. After the straw is cut by the cutter 10, the reel 5 pushes the straw into the throwing claw 3, and then the throwing claw 3 drives the straw to move, clamps to the left and throws it down, which is located in front of the equipment The stalk on the left is directly cut off by the cutter 10 of the driven shaft 8, and is directly thrown to the left. The harvesting part works continuously under the drive of the engine 19, and the body part also drives the whole equipment to constantly walk forward.
本发明还能将收割部分单独拆下来安装在手扶拖拉机上,由手扶拖拉机的柴油机来驱动主动轴的转动,带动收割部分的收割工作。 In the present invention, the harvesting part can be separately removed and installed on the walking tractor, and the driving shaft is driven by the diesel engine of the walking tractor to drive the harvesting work of the harvesting part.
综上,本发明结构简单,操作方便,工作效率高,适应性好,便于进行大规模的推广应用。 To sum up, the present invention has simple structure, convenient operation, high work efficiency, good adaptability, and is convenient for large-scale popularization and application.
